About Edward Kim, M.D., PHD
Edward Kim, M.D., PHD is a Hematology & Oncology healthcare provider based in Sacramento, California. This provider has been registered with the National Plan and Provider Enumeration System (NPPES) since 03/27/2007. The National Provider Identifier (NPI) number assigned to this provider is 1033237987.
According to the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S) Open Payments database, Edward Kim, M.D., PHD has received a total of $145,977 in payments from pharmaceutical and medical device companies, with $36,421 received in 2024. These payments were reported across 97 transactions from 9 companies. The most common payment nature is "Compensation for services other than consulting, including serving as faculty or as a speaker at a venue other than a continuing education program" ($62,605).
As a Medicare-enrolled provider, Kim has provided services to 995 Medicare beneficiaries, totaling 1,843 services with total Medicare billing of $156,922. Data is available for 4 years (2020–2023), covering 27 distinct procedure/service records.
